This is an exciting new role for a Data Analyst to join our leading IT Client based in Newcastle.
With previous experience in an IT operations environment, you will be required to develop and implement data storage, analysis and reporting solutions for key customer reports and billing.
Reporting to the Workstream Lead, you will also facilitate the development and deployment of office automation and will be responsible for delivering a defined set of activities according to a pre-planned schedule.
This is a diverse role and responsibilities will include:
* Establish and manage suitable data repositories in SharePoint and legacy network shares to allow cross function, collaborative working
* Generate suitable analysis and reporting tooling within excel to track complex and often time critical KPIs
* Provide SME advice with respect to automation and tooling in ongoing process improvement initiatives
* Understand and be able to interpret contractual reporting and data management requirements
The ideal candidate will have knowledge of MS Excel (Expert), VLOOKUP, pivot tables, advanced formulae and conditional formatting. It would also be preferred for candidates to hold relevant ICT/ITIL qualifications.
If you have strong interpersonal and communication skills across all levels of management, are comfortable working in pressurized environments and are available to work occasional anti-sociable hours, then this could be your ideal role.
Please note that the post holder must have or be able to obtain SC security clearance.
